Logitech prices up by as much as 25% as tariffs kick in - 9to5Mac

Logitech prices have increased by as much as 25%, in what is almost certainly the result of tariffs kicking in on products imported from China.Not all prices have gone up, so if you have your eye on one of the unaffected accessories, now might be a good time to buy … A video by Cameron Dougherty breaks down the the price raises.As is often the case, however, better prices can be found on Amazon, in some cases wiping out the price increase.

The MX Ergo mouse and the G703 gaming mouse are among the products whose prices remain unchanged, so if you’re planning to buy one of these, you may want to do so sooner rather than later.Dougherty notes that Logitech pricing often influences its competitors, so we may well see other brands introducing similar increases.Check out the full video below.
